תוכן עניינים:
- שלב 1: חומרים
- שלב 2: החיווט
- שלב 3: קוד - הצהרת המשתנים שלך
- שלב 4: קוד - הגדרה
- שלב 5:
- שלב 6: הבסיס
- שלב 7: ביצוע ספין הגוף
וִידֵאוֹ: רובוט: 7 שלבים (עם תמונות)
2024 מְחַבֵּר: John Day | [email protected]. שונה לאחרונה: 2024-01-30 09:17
לפרויקט הגמר שלנו נאמר לנו לבנות מה שנרצה. בעזרת מה שלמדנו, ומה שאנחנו יכולים למצוא באינטרנט. אני מעריץ ענק של הסדרה Super Smash Bros. אני הבעלים של כל המשחקים למעט הראשון. אז לפרויקט הגמר שלי, החלטתי לבנות רובוט המבוסס על הדמות הניתנת לשחק R. O. B.
שלב 1: חומרים
- סרוו 4 180 מעלות
- 13 זכר - חוטי זכר
- 8 חוטי זכר - נקבה
- 2 ג'ויסטיקים
- לוח אחד
- 1 ארדואינו
שלב 2: החיווט
השתמש בחוט זכר-זכר כדי לחבר את הצד השלילי של לוח הלחם לקרקע (GND) על הארדואינו. לאחר מכן חבר את ה- VR X של הג'ויסטיק ל- A0 ו- A2, ואת ה- VR Y ל- A1 ו- A3 ב- Arduino. לאחר מכן חבר את הג'ויסטיקס 5v לסיכות 3.5 ו- 5V ב- Arduino, ואת ה- GND לכל GND ב- Arduino. לאחר מכן, עבור כל אחד מארבעת הסרבים, חבר את החוט הלבן לסיכות 7 - 4 בארדואינו. לאחר מכן חבר את החוט האדום בסרווס ללוח החיובי בצד החיובי, וחבר את החוט השחור לצד השלילי של לוח הלחם. לאחר מכן חבר את תיבת הסוללות כדי להפעיל את המעגל.
שלב 3: קוד - הצהרת המשתנים שלך
#לִכלוֹל
סרוו סרוו 1; סרוו סרוו 2; סרוו סרוו 3; סרוו סרוו 4; int joyX = 0; int joyY = 1; int joyX2 = 2; int joyY2 = 3; int joyVal; int joyVal2;
פקודת סרוו יוצרת אובייקט סרוו לשליטה בסרוו.
שלב 4: קוד - הגדרה
התקנת void () {// מצרפת כל סרוו לסיכות servo1.attach (7); servo2.attach (6); servo3.attach (5); servo4.attach (4); }
שלב 5:
לולאת חלל ()
{
joyVal = analogRead (joyX); // קורא את ערך הג'ויסטיק joyVal = map (joyVal, 0, 1023, 0, 180); // ממיר את ערכי הג'ויסטיק למעלות servo1.write (joyVal); // משנה את מיקום הסרוו כך שיתאים לקלט הג'ויסטיק joyVal = map (joyVal, 0, 1023, 0, 180); servo2.write (joyVal); עיכוב (15); joyVal2 = analogRead (joyX2); joyVal2 = מפה (joyVal2, 0, 1023, 0, 180); servo3.write (joyVal2); joyVal = analogRead (joyY2); joyVal2 = מפה (joyVal2, 0, 1023, 0, 180); servo4.write (joyVal2); עיכוב (15); }
שלב 6: הבסיס
אז לאחר שתסיים את המעגל והקוד. אתה יכול להתחיל לבנות את הרובוט בפועל. לבסיס אתה רוצה להפוך את כל הזוויות ל 45 מעלות. הצדדים הארוכים הם 18 ס"מ והמכנסיים הקצרים 6 ס"מ. אז פשוט עקוב אחר התמונה וגזור את צורת הבסיס שלנו. לאחר מכן צור 2 רצועות באורך 54 ס"מ וברוחב 5 ס"מ לשימוש כקירות. השאירו את הצדדים הקטנים בגודל 6 ס"מ פתוחים. אז אתה רוצה לשכפל את הבסיס כדי ליצור את הגג. עכשיו בתא הזה, אנחנו הולכים להוסיף את
שלב 7: ביצוע ספין הגוף
קבל גליל מגבת נייר והדבק אותו באקדח דבק חם לאמצע הגג. לאחר מכן יוצרים טבעות בגובה 6 ס מ מסביב לבסיס גליל מגבות הנייר. לאחר מכן צור צלחת גדולה עם חור גדול מספיק כדי להתאים את גליל מגבות הנייר דרכו. מניחים את הצלחת על הטבעת, ואז מדביקים סרוו בחלק העליון של גליל מגבות הנייר. אנחנו לא יכולים לשים את כל המשקל על הסרוו. אז נשתמש במקלות מקלות וכדי לגרום לזה להסתובב. אז צור 2 חורים בצלחת מספיק גדולים כדי להתאים לכמה דיבלים. תקע את הסמלים לתוך החור, מספיק שאז הוא קצת חודר בתחתית החור. קלטת/ דבק חם אקדח את הדיבלים אל החור כדי שלא יזוז. קח קופסת טישו ריקה וצור חורים גדולים מספיק כך שיתאימו לקצה השני של הדיבלים. כמו כן וודא שהמרחב יהיה מספיק רחב עד ששני הדיבלים יוכלו לעבור. לאחר מכן הדביקו את הקופסה לסרוו, והדביקו את הדיבלים לתוך חורי תיבת המרקמים. הדביקו / הדביקו חם את הסמכים לחורים כך שלא יזוז.
מוּמלָץ:
גורילהבוט רובוט ארדואינו המודפס בתלת מימד, רובוט מרובע: 9 שלבים (עם תמונות)
גורילהבוט רובוט ארדואינו המודפס בתלת מימד, רובוט מרובע: כל שנה בטולוז (צרפת) מתקיים מרוץ רובוט טולוז #TRR2021 המרוץ מורכב מספרינט אוטונומי בגובה 10 מטרים לרובוטים דו -רגליים וריבועים. השיא הנוכחי שאני אוסף עבור מרובע הוא 42 שניות למשך ספרינט של 10 מטר. אז עם זה ב- m
[DIY] רובוט עכביש (רובוט מרובע, מרובע): 14 שלבים (עם תמונות)
[עשה זאת בעצמך] רובוט עכביש (Quad Robot, Quadruped): אם תזדקק לתמיכה נוספת ממני, עדיף שתעשה לי תרומה מתאימה: http: //paypal.me/RegisHsu2019-10-10 עדכון: המהדר החדש יגרום לבעיית חישוב המספרים הצפים. שיניתי את הקוד כבר. 26/03/2017
רובוט ג'וי (רובו דה אלגריה) - קוד פתוח בתלת -ממד מודפס, רובוט מופעל בארדואינו !: 18 שלבים (עם תמונות)
רובוט ג'וי (Robô Da Alegria) - קוד פתוח בהדפסה תלת מימדית, רובוט מופעל על ידי Arduino !: פרס ראשון בתחרות גלגלי ההוראה, פרס שני בתחרות Arduino Instructables, ורב שני בתחרות עיצוב לילדים. תודה לכל מי שהצביע עלינו !!! רובוטים מגיעים לכל מקום. מיישומים תעשייתיים ועד לך
רובוט איזון / רובוט 3 גלגלים / רובוט STEM: 8 שלבים
רובוט איזון / רובוט 3 גלגלים / רובוט STEM: בנינו רובוט איזון משולב ושלושה גלגלים לשימוש חינוכי בבתי ספר ובתוכניות חינוכיות לאחר הלימודים. הרובוט מבוסס על Arduino Uno, מגן מותאם אישית (כל פרטי הבנייה מסופקים), חבילת סוללות לי יון (כל מבנה
[רובוט ארדואינו] כיצד ליצור רובוט לכידת תנועה - רובוט אגודל - מנוע סרוו - קוד מקור: 26 שלבים (עם תמונות)
[רובוט ארדואינו] כיצד ליצור רובוט לכידת תנועה | רובוט אגודל | מנוע סרוו | קוד מקור: רובוט אגודל. השתמש בפוטנציומטר של מנוע סרוו MG90S. זה מאוד כיף וקל! הקוד פשוט מאוד. זה בסביבות 30 קווים בלבד. זה נראה כמו לכידת תנועה. אנא השאר כל שאלה או משוב! [הוראה] קוד מקור https: //github.c